Below is a list of my favorite episodes from Season Four of the Syfy Channel series, "EUREKA". Created by Andrew Cosby and Jaime Paglia, the series starred Colin Ferguson:

"FAVORITE "EUREKA" SEASON FOUR (2010-2011) Episodes



1. (4.01) "Founder's Day" - During the Founder's Day celebration for Eureka; Sheriff Jack Carter, Dr. Allison Blake, Dr. Douglas Fargo, Dr. Henry Deacon, and Deputy Jo Lupo mysteriously time travel back to 1947, in the middle of the army base that existed before the town was founded.



2. (4.15) "Omega Girls" - Allison becomes a danger to the community when she is subjected to mind control by former nemesis Dr. Beverly Barlowe, who wants to steal Eureka's secrets.



3. (4.20) "One Giant Leap" - Hours before the launch of Global Dynamics' Titan mission, the citizens of Eureka struggle with black holes and deciding over who will stay and who will go.



4. (4.11) "Lift Off" - Efforts are made to rescue Zane and Fargo from space after they get caught trapped by an accidental launch of what was supposed to be an unmanned mission to test a new FTL drive.



5. (4.09) "I'll Be Seeing You" - Beverly and the Consortium try to return time travel visitor Dr. Trevor Grant back to 1947 using the powercell from the stolen DED device to power their own space-time bridge forming device. A power surge from the device endangers Allison's life. And when Carter interrupts their work, he and Grant are trapped in the past.



Honorable Mention: (4.02) "A New World" - Eureka's time travelers return to the present and discover that some aspects of their lives have changed. They also discover that Dr. Grant had accompanied them from 1947.
